Dominican security system dysfunctional: Ex-New York mayor
Santo Domingo.- Former New York mayor Rudolph Giuliani on Wednesday called Dominican Republic?s current security system ?dysfunctional? and must be fixed from top to bottom.
"We must end corruption from the top down. But if you cannot end corruption at the top, corruption at the bottom cannot end," he said to unveil the security plan for the platform of opposition PRM party presidential candidate Luis Abinader.
Giuliani said the country needs a computerized system that collects statistics and a map where the crimes being committed can be seen.
"This country has too crimes against women are ignored and that should be changed with a unit of specialization victims," ??he said, noting that only forensics should determine the cause of death because in his view there are many cases of homicides classified as an accident.
"There must be doping tests on cops?laws that don?t allow weapons to be used by people who have mental problems," he said.
Giuliani added that a DNA bank should be created, and as an example said in his country, 10 percent of murder are resolved by taking suspects? DNA.
